Skyline had already won two in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 2 goals) and they went ahead and made it three on Wednesday. Their defense stepped up to hand the Olympus Titans a 1-0 shutout. The score was all tied up 0-0 at the break, but Skyline were the better team in the second half.
The win got Skyline back to even at 4-4. As for Olympus, their defeat was their fourth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 2-6.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Skyline will have some time to savor their victory since their next game is a little ways off: they'll take on West at 3:30 p.m. on the 18th. As for Olympus, they will look to defend their home pitch on Friday against Brighton at 7:00 p.m. Olympus are facing Brighton at the right time seeing as Brighton are stuck on a four-game losing streak.
